This study is conducted because the author finds out that most of his students have a low reading ability and motivation in learning Narrative text. This study aims to improve students’ motivation and reading ability in learning Narrative text by applying the Problem-based Learning model in the 9C grade student s of SMP N 1 Watukumpul. Data collection techniques used were observation, and testing. Data analysis techniques used comparative descriptive techniques and critical analysis. The conclusions of this study were Problem-based Learning can improve students’ learning motivation and their reading ability in learning narrative text. The average score of motivation obtained in the first cycle of action amounted to 59,25 and 76,125 in the second cycle. While the average of student reading ability in learning narrative text in pre-action amounted to 58, in the first cycle amounted to 68 and 79 in the second cycle. From the average score of students’ motivation and students’ reading ability, it can be concluded that Problem-based Learning can improve students’ motivation and reading ability in learning Narrative text.

This research is motivated by the interest in learning of SMK Taman Karya Madya Pertambangan Kebumen students which are classified as low criteria with an average of 37.5%. Meanwhile, students' mathematics learning outcomes are also still unsatisfactory, with no students who complete with an average score of 58.33. Based on the problems above with Power Point (PPT) media. in increasing interest and learning outcomes of mathematics in linear program material for students of Class X SMK Taman Karya Madya Pertambangan Kebumen. 12 children as subjects and carried. Showed that interest in learning increased from the pre-cycle results from the low category with an average of 37.5% to the medium category with an average of 63.02%. Furthermore, in the implementation in cycle 2, interest in learning again increased to the high category with an average of an average of 77.60%. Likewise, the percentage of students who completed the learning outcomes test increased from the pre-cycle results to an average of 58.33 to 73.75 and in the second cycle increased to 80.83. Likewise, the percentage of students who completed the mathematics learning outcomes test increased to 83.33%.

This Classroom Action Research (CAR) aims to increase students' interest and learning outcomes in mathematics at SMK Bhakti Praja Margasari by applying problem-based learning (PBL) techniques. This research uses problem-based learning about story questions that other researchers have rarely done before. This research was conducted by adapting the Kemmis and McTaggart model into four stages: planning, implementation, observation, and consideration. A total of 32 students of class XAKL 1 SMK Bhakti Praja Margasai were used as the subjects of this study. Three tools were used to collect data: a questionnaire, an observation sheet, and a test. Learning outcomes data were analyzed quantitatively, while interest and practice data were analyzed qualitatively. The analysis showed that the students' interest in mathematics and their learning outcomes increased from the initial state. At the end of the second cycle, the PBL learning method met the objectives/ criteria for success. This means that 75% of students have reached the KKM. Students' interest in learning also meets the goals/criteria for indicators of success. This means that 78.13% of students are interested in learning in the "very high" category and 18.75% of students are interested in learning in the "high" category. Some conclusions from this CAR are: First, after a two-action cycle, the PBL method was proven to increase interest in learning and learning outcomes for students of class X AKLI 1 SMK Bhakti Praja Margasari. Second, the growth of student interest in learning is appreciated by the active role of students through the use of PBL. Third, presenting mathematical problems through narrative questions that are close to the context of students' daily lives, thus facilitating understanding of abstract mathematical concepts and increasing not only student interest but also learning outcomes. Fourth, the success of PBL implementation is highly dependent on the consistency of the teacher acting as a facilitator. The results of this study provide empirical evidence about the importance of planning, monitoring, and improving CAR-based learning.

Student learning outcomes about the material for writing fantasy story texts have not reached minimal learning mastery because of the lack of student activity in learning. The purpose of this study was to increase the activeness and learning outcomes of students in learning to write fantasy story texts. The form of this research is classroom action research. The research subjects were students of class VIIG of SMP Negeri 4 Sragen. Research through the assessment process based on CAR which includes four stages, namely planning, implementation, observation, and reflection. Based on the results of the action data analysis, it can be concluded that the application of strip story media is able to improve the ability to write fantasy story texts for class VIIG students of SMP Negeri 4 Sragen in the 2020/2021 academic year. Improved learning outcomes of writing fantasy story texts, students who scored above the KBM in the initial conditions were 35,72% of students, increased to 67,68% in cycle 1, and in cycle 2 increased to 82,14%. The active learning of students with certain indicators also increases. From the initial condition 40,72% to 60,71% in cycle 1, and in cycle 2 increased to 81,43%. The indicators are: active students to ask questions, express opinions, answer questions, do assignments, and present learning outcomes.

The purpose of this Class Action Research is to increase learning activities and learning outcomes of student adjustment journal X AKL B SMKN 3 Sukoharjo Semester 2 of The 2019/2020 Study Year. The method used is class action research with 2 cycles. The subject of his research was the application of a combination of the Problem Based Learning (PBL) model with Number Head Together (NHT). The research object of students of class X AKL B amounted to 36 people. The study used quantitative data in the form of values, interviews, and field records. Data collection techniques by means of documentation, tests, and observations. The result of this class action research is an increase in activity and student learning outcomes compiling an adjustment journal in students of class X AKL B SMK Negeri 3 Sukoharjo Semester 2 of The Year of Study 2019/2020 judging by the increasing percentage of learning outcomes from cycle I by 63.89% to 86.11% in cycle II. The increase in student learning activity increased from 13.35% in cycle I to 17.69% in cycle II. The conclusion of this research is the application of a combination of the PBL learning model with NHT can increase learning activities and learning outcomes of the journal of adjustment of students of class X AKL B SMK Negeri 3 Sukoharjo Semester 2 of The 2019/2020 School Year.
